How can companies effectively balance the need for remote work flexibility with the importance of maintaining high levels of cybersecurity and customer data protection?
Companies can effectively balance the need for remote work flexibility with cybersecurity by implementing strong security measures such as multi-factor authentication, encryption, and regular security training for employees. They can also utilize secure virtual private networks (VPNs) and ensure that all devices accessing company data are secure and up-to-date. Additionally, companies should have clear policies in place regarding the handling of customer data and regularly monitor and audit their systems for any potential vulnerabilities or breaches. By prioritizing cybersecurity and data protection while allowing for remote work flexibility, companies can maintain a secure work environment for their employees and customers.
